Amphenol RF 082-4336 N Type Coaxial Connector Plug Equivalent & Substitute Parts
Part Overview
The Amphenol RF 082-4336 is an N Type connector plug with male pin configuration, designed for 50 ohm coaxial cable termination via solder attachment. This component operates across RF applications up to 11 GHz and is compatible with standard coaxial cable groups including RG-8, RG-9, and related variants. The part is classified as obsolete, necessitating identification of active equivalent alternatives for ongoing procurement and system integration.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
Substitution of the obsolete 082-4336 is based on strict electrical and mechanical parameter alignment. The primary substitute, Amphenol RF 172176, maintains equivalence through the following critical parameters:
Electrical Equivalence Criteria:
- Identical impedance specification: 50 Ohms
- Matching frequency maximum: 11 GHz
- Equivalent insertion loss: 0.15 dB
- Identical voltage rating: 1500 V
- Matching mating cycle rating: 500 cycles
Mechanical Equivalence Criteria:
- Identical connector style: N Type
- Identical connector type: Plug, Male Pin
- Identical contact termination method: Solder
- Identical shield termination method: Crimp
- Identical fastening type: Threaded
- Compatible cable group support: RG-8, 8A, 9, 9A, 9B, 87, 213, 214, 225, 302, 393
Compliance Equivalence:
- Matching operating temperature range: -65°C to 165°C
- RoHS compliance maintained (RoHS3 Compliant for substitute)
- Moisture sensitivity level: 1 (Unlimited)
The 172176 substitute differs in mounting configuration (right angle vs. straight), housing finish (white bronze vs. silver), and center contact material (beryllium copper vs. brass), but these variations do not affect electrical performance or core functional compatibility for standard N Type plug applications.

Engineering Selection Recommendations
Primary Substitute: Amphenol RF 172176
The 172176 is the designated substitute for the obsolete 082-4336 based on complete electrical and mechanical parameter alignment. Selection of this substitute is supported by:
-
Product Status: The 172176 maintains active product status with current manufacturing support, ensuring long-term availability and supply chain continuity.
-
Compliance Certification: The 172176 carries ROHS3 compliance, exceeding the RoHS compliance of the original part and meeting current regulatory requirements.
-
Electrical Performance: All critical electrical parameters are identical, including impedance, frequency response, insertion loss, voltage rating, and mating cycle specifications.
-
Mechanical Compatibility: The connector maintains N Type plug configuration with solder contact termination and crimp shield termination, ensuring compatibility with existing cable assemblies and termination procedures.
-
Environmental Specifications: Operating temperature range and moisture sensitivity level remain unchanged, preserving thermal and environmental performance characteristics.
Mounting Configuration Consideration: The 172176 features right-angle mounting versus the straight configuration of the 082-4336. Physical space constraints and cable routing requirements must be evaluated during integration planning.
Material Differences: The substitute incorporates beryllium copper center contacts and white bronze body finish. These material changes enhance durability and environmental resistance without affecting electrical performance.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can the 172176 directly replace the 082-4336 in existing assemblies?
A: Electrical and functional replacement is direct. Physical mounting orientation differs due to right-angle configuration. Cable routing and connector positioning must be assessed for mechanical fit within the application.
Q: Are the solder termination procedures identical between the two parts?
A: Both parts utilize solder contact termination and crimp shield termination. Standard N Type connector soldering procedures apply to both components without modification.
Q: What is the significance of the beryllium copper center contact in the 172176?
A: Beryllium copper provides enhanced mechanical durability and improved contact resistance stability compared to brass. This material change does not alter electrical performance but extends component service life.
Q: Does the weatherproof ingress protection of the 172176 affect compatibility?
A: The weatherproof rating of the 172176 is an enhancement that does not restrict compatibility. Applications not requiring weatherproofing are unaffected by this specification.
Q: Are both parts compatible with the same cable groups?
A: Yes. Both the 082-4336 and 172176 support identical cable group compatibility: RG-8, 8A, 9, 9A, 9B, 87, 213, 214, 225, 302, and 393.
